How the Online Search Interface Functions

Most users begin their search through a web portal optimized for mobile and desktop use. These interfaces are built to be simple, often requiring only a last name or alias. Some systems allow advanced filters, such as date of birth or booking date, to narrow down results quickly. Once a query is submitted, the system scans internal databases and returns a list of matching records. Each record usually shows basic identifiers, current status, and upcoming court dates if applicable. Users should understand that the system updates on a schedule, so real-time details might not always be immediately visible.

Understanding Release Information and Status Updates

Release information is one of the most frequently accessed parts of the record. This includes scheduled release dates, reasons for release, and any conditions that may apply. A person might be released on their own recognizance, after posting bail, or at the end of a sentence. The status field often changes as the case progresses through the legal system. For example, an inmate may move from "detained" to "transferred" or "released" depending on court decisions. Staying informed through official channels helps family members and case managers coordinate logistics and avoid confusion.

What Information Is Available to the Public?

Public records typically include the inmate’s name, date of birth, booking number, charges, and current facility location. This data supports transparency and allows families to confirm details without needing direct intervention. However, sensitive information such as social security numbers, full addresses, and medical details are redacted for protection. How Often Is the Information Updated?

The frequency of updates depends on the policies of the specific detention facility. In some cases, status changes are reflected within hours, while in others, there may be a delay of several days. Processing times can be affected by staffing levels, system maintenance, and the volume of entries. For this reason, users are encouraged to check periodically rather than assuming a single search provides the final answer. Treating the information as a snapshot in time rather than a permanent record leads to a more accurate understanding.

Can Errors Appear in Public Records?

Mistakes can occasionally occur due to similar names, data entry issues, or incomplete updates. If someone notices a discrepancy, the best step is to contact the official office directly for clarification. Providing identification and specific details helps staff correct the record efficiently. Relying on unofficial sources or rumors can spread misinformation quickly.
